Year-End Tax Settlement

Year-end settlement is the process where your employer (the withholding agent) recalculates and finalizes the income tax on your last-year wages. It usually runs Jan–Feb through your company: if you overpaid you get a refund, if you underpaid you pay more. Foreign workers with Korea wage income are included. The NTS ‘simplified service’ gathers your deduction data in one place.

What to prepare

  • ARC / passport
  • Proof for deductions (medical, donations, rent, education, if applicable)
  • The forms your company requests (deduction declaration, etc.)

How to proceed

  1. 1Get the year-end guidance and schedule from your employer (usually Jan–Feb)
  2. 2On Hometax (web) or Sontax (app) ‘simplified service,’ check and download your deduction data
  3. 3Submit that data plus any extra deduction proof to your company (or via Hometax easy-submit)
  4. 4After your company finalizes it, the refund/extra charge appears in your February (or March) pay
  5. 5If you quit or changed jobs mid-year, you may need to submit documents before your final paycheck

Tips

  • Foreign workers may elect a ‘flat-rate special’ — whichever is more favorable vs. the progressive rate. ⚠️ Eligibility, rate, and period change yearly, so we don’t state figures here; confirm on Hometax/NTS (see the ‘Flat Tax Rate’ guide).
  • Some costs are not deductible — e.g. overseas medical bills, foreign credit-card spending, children’s overseas education. Check in advance what counts.
  • Deduction items, limits, and rates change every year — don’t assume amounts; confirm via Hometax or a tax accountant.
  • Mid-year quitting/changing jobs or having two-plus employers can make settlement complex — if stuck, call NTS ☎126 (foreigners: English help ☎1588-0560).
  • ⚠️ If you have income not settled here (multiple jobs, freelance, business), you may need to file comprehensive income tax next May — missing it can bring penalty tax and other downsides (verify amounts officially).
